Hatsune Miku and NewDays collaboration returns once again but this time with Snow Miku to support Hokkaido! The collaboration, in celebration of Hokkaido’s 150th anniversary, will be bringing a variety of Hokkaido’s specialties starting today at all NewDays, NewDays KIOSK, and KIOSK shops until August 6th. Also included are clear files upon purchases and stamp rally with various prizes.

Fans who make purchases over 700 yen from now until July 23rd will receive a limited edition clear file of Snow Miku in NewDays uniform by KEI, where a second clear file by Mame no Moto will substitute in from July 24th until the end of collaboration. This makes it the second year we’re seeing Miku in her NewDays and JR East uniforms.

A stamp rally with QR codes will also be carried out. The rewards start out small from various designs of clear files to a limited edition Shinkalion the Animation postcard (where Miku piloted a bullet train transforming robot, and yes you read that right), and eventually, a special video with the names of winners called out by Miku herself.

In celebration of the launch of the campaign today, a new music video titled “NEWDAYS” by Michita has been released featuring Hatsune Miku and a Japanese music artist “pinoko” rapping together about Hokkaido. Movie & illustration courtesy of the artist iXima himself.

That was a bit faster than we expected! The stunning Hatsune Miku: My Dear Bunny ver. scale figure from FREEing is already available for preorder starting today!

The popular “My Dear Bunny” module transformed into a 1/4th scale figure!

From the arcade rhythm game “Hatsune Miku Project DIVA Arcade” comes a 1/4th scale figure of Hatsune Miku wearing the “My Dear Bunny” module outfit!

The exquisite gradient of her twin-tails and overall detail of her outfit has been captured in beautiful detail thanks to the large scale! Her net tights are made from real fabric for a truly authentic appearance that really brings out her charm! Be sure to add the carefree and energetic Bunny Miku to your collection!

The figure is available for preorder from Good Smile Company’s online shop until September 6th at 12:00 PM JST. Her price is set at 28,800 Yen ($269.99 USD), although this may vary among different online stores. she’s expected to ship sometime in April 2019.

According to a recent TOKYO MX television broadcast, several key details of the Hatsune Miku: Magical Mirai 2018 events have been detailed. Here’s what was announced in the broadcast:

1. Osaka and Tokyo will have different setlists. Possibly a 7~8 song difference between the two venues.
2. The theme song “Greenlights Serenade” will hold some kind of special significance during the concert. (Possible surprises)
3. A lot of high-energy changes to the music setlist. (A very tiring setlist!)
4. No details yet of a Kansai region collaboration (where Osaka is located), will be announced in the future, hopefully.
5: Life-sized Magical Mirai 2018 version Miku statue production in progress.

FREEing has displayed a fully pained version of their Hatsune Miku: My Dear Bunny ver. 1/4 scale figure at the CCG Expo in Shanghai, China earlier today. This is our first glimpse of the figure’s painted prototype, and gives us a good look from all angles. We love the attention to outfit detail with real fabric used for the fishnet pantyhose!

The figure is based on Hassan’s winning design from SEGA’s module design contest for Project Diva Arcade: Future Tone, which was released as a playable outfit in the game in 2017. According to the display, they are planning to open the figure for orders in January 2019 for 26,667 JPY ($242 USD).

The world-famous virtual singer Hatsune Miku will be performing live with her friendly YouTuber in the neighborhood Kizuna AI this September at the Tokyo Kabuki Girls show. The show is presented by Tokyo Girls Collection, a biannual Japanese fashion festival held since August 2005, as a grand collaboration with casts beyond genres from Vocaloid, models, artists, performers, and more.

Tokyo Kabuki Girls will be held at Shin Kabuki-za in Osaka on September 15th~16th. Ticket pre-sale is currently live on eplus. It’s rather a small world, a virtual world even.
